服务器mt是什么意思啊
-
服务器MT指的是服务器的Mean Time,也被称为平均故障修复时间。它是衡量服务器稳定性和可靠性的一个重要指标。服务器MT是指在服务器发生故障后,从故障发生到修复完成的平均时间。服务器MT通常以小时或分钟为单位进行统计。
服务器MT的计算方式可以通过将每次故障修复所花费的总时间相加,然后除以故障次数来得到。它可以帮助企业了解服务器的稳定性和可靠性,以及识别和解决常见的故障问题。较低的服务器MT意味着故障修复的速度更快,服务器可用性更高,对业务的影响时间更短。
要降低服务器MT,可以采取以下措施:
- 定期进行服务器维护和保养,包括软件更新、安全补丁安装和硬件检查等;
- 配备备用服务器或冗余组件,以便当一个服务器发生故障时,可以迅速切换到备用服务器;
- 使用监控工具实时监测服务器的运行状态,及时捕捉和处理故障;
- 建立有效的故障排除流程和员工培训计划,以确保故障能够快速定位和修复;
- 定期备份服务器的数据,以防止数据丢失和恢复时间延长。
通过以上措施,可以提高服务器的稳定性和可靠性,降低服务器MT,最大限度地减少因服务器故障而引起的业务中断时间。
1年前 -
服务器MT是指"Server Management Tool",即服务器管理工具。这是一种用于管理和监控服务器的软件或工具,可以帮助管理员轻松地管理服务器的各种功能和任务。服务器MT通常具有以下功能:
- 远程管理:服务器MT允许管理员通过远程访问方式管理服务器,无需亲自到服务器所在地点。管理员可以通过网络连接到服务器,执行各种管理任务,例如配置服务器设置、安装更新、监控性能等。
- 自动化操作:服务器MT可以自动化执行某些任务,例如自动备份数据、定期检查服务器健康状况、自动修复常见问题等。这减轻了管理员的工作负担,并提高了服务器的稳定性和可靠性。
- 性能监控:服务器MT可以监控服务器的性能指标,例如CPU使用率、内存使用率、磁盘空间占用等。管理员可以实时查看这些指标,并根据需要进行调整和优化,以确保服务器正常运行。
- 安全管理:服务器MT可以帮助管理员加强服务器的安全性。它提供了各种安全功能,例如防火墙设置、访问控制、安全审计等。管理员可以使用服务器MT来控制和监控服务器的安全性,以防止潜在的安全威胁。
- 资源管理:服务器MT可以帮助管理员有效地管理服务器资源。它提供了资源分配和调度的功能,例如分配磁盘空间、分配带宽、管理用户访问权限等。管理员可以使用服务器MT来管理服务器资源,以优化服务器的性能和使用效率。
总之,服务器MT是一种有助于简化和优化服务器管理的工具。它提供了许多功能,帮助管理员轻松管理和监控服务器的各个方面,以确保服务器的稳定性和性能。
1年前 -
服务器mt是指服务器主题,全称为Multi-threaded Server。它是一种多线程服务器模型,用于处理多个客户端请求。下文将详细介绍服务器mt模型的定义、优点、缺点以及实现方法。
1. 服务器mt模型的定义
服务器mt模型是指在服务器端采用多线程的方式来处理并发连接的请求。每当有一个客户端发起连接请求时,服务器都会创建一个新的线程来处理该请求,从而实现多个客户端同时和服务器进行通信。
2. 服务器mt模型的优点
- 高并发处理能力: 多线程技术可以使服务器同时处理多个并发连接的请求,提高服务器的并发处理能力。
- 快速响应客户端: 采用多线程模型,每个客户端连接都会分配一个独立的线程进行处理,能够快速响应客户端请求,减少客户端的等待时间。
- 简化逻辑处理: 每个线程处理一个客户端连接的请求,使得逻辑处理更加简化,提高代码的可读性和可维护性。
3. 服务器mt模型的缺点
- 线程开销大: 每个并发连接都需要创建一个新线程来处理,线程创建和销毁的开销较大,会消耗大量的系统资源。
- 线程竞争导致性能下降: 多个线程同时访问共享资源,容易引发线程竞争问题,导致性能下降或产生线程安全问题。
- 内存占用增大: 每个线程都需要一定的内存来存储线程堆栈和局部变量,当并发连接数量较大时,会导致内存占用增加。
4. 实现服务器mt模型的方法
实现服务器mt模型的方法有多种,这里介绍一种常用的实现方式。
4.1 创建服务器Socket
首先,使用Socket类创建服务器Socket,并指定服务器监听的端口号。
ServerSocket serverSocket = new ServerSocket(port);4.2 接收客户端连接请求
使用ServerSocket的accept()方法接受客户端的连接请求,并创建一个新的Socket与客户端进行通信。
Socket socket = serverSocket.accept();4.3 创建线程处理客户端请求
每当有一个客户端连接成功,就创建一个新的线程来处理该客户端的请求。可以使用Java的Thread类来创建线程,并重写run()方法来实现具体的业务逻辑。
Thread thread = new Thread(new ClientHandler(socket)); thread.start();4.4 客户端请求处理逻辑
在ClientHandler线程的run()方法中,实现具体的客户端请求处理逻辑。这里可以根据实际需求编写自己的业务代码,比如接收和发送数据等。
public class ClientHandler implements Runnable { private Socket socket; public ClientHandler(Socket socket) { this.socket = socket; } @Override public void run() { // 处理客户端请求 } }通过以上方法,我们可以实现一个具有多线程处理能力的服务器mt模型。每个客户端连接都会分配一个独立的线程进行处理,从而达到处理并发连接的目的。
总之,服务器mt模型能够有效提高服务器的并发处理能力和响应速度,但同时也需要注意线程安全和资源消耗的问题。在实际应用中,需要根据具体需求和系统性能进行选择和优化。
1年前